Sports clubs succeed when they distinguish themselves through genuine operational competence, not just equipment. A facility that stands out keeps accurate booking systems so members actually get their reserved time, maintains courts and equipment to a consistent standard rather than letting them deteriorate, and employs staff or coaches who know the sport deeply enough to help members understand what they're doing wrong. Experienced clubs develop relationships with local schools and junior development programmes because they understand how to structure coaching for different ages, not just offer open access. They manage membership fairly, enforce rules that protect the playing experience, and invest in maintenance before problems become obvious. When you're evaluating a sports facility, look for signs that someone cares about the details—the court surface condition, how equipment is stored, whether the lighting actually works properly, how staff handle booking conflicts. These things reveal whether the club is run by people who actually play, or people who simply rent space.
